Pricing

Union Court Assisted Living presents a compelling financial offer for those considering assisted living options in Jefferson County, Colorado. With a monthly cost of $2,500 for a semi-private room and $3,200 for a private room, Union Court stands out as an affordable alternative compared to the county's average costs of $4,114 for semi-private accommodations and $4,253 for private ones. Even relative to state averages of $4,009 and $4,142 respectively, Union Court offers significant savings without compromising on quality of care. This makes it an attractive choice for families seeking value while ensuring their loved ones receive the support they need in a comfortable environment.

Room TypeUnion Court Assisted LivingJefferson CountyColorado
Semi-Private$2,500$4,114$4,009
Private$3,200$4,253$4,142

Review

The reviews of Union Court indicate a significant decline in the quality and care provided at this facility, highlighting the disappointment and frustration felt by families who entrusted their loved ones to it. Once considered a beautiful setting for elderly care, the establishment has seemingly transformed under new ownership into a place where financial motives overshadow genuine concern for resident wellbeing. According to multiple accounts, the current owner’s priority appears to be profit rather than providing a safe and nurturing environment for residents. This perception is underscored by the excessive price increases that many reviewers reported, leading families to question the value they are receiving in exchange for their spending.

Critics have raised serious concerns about staffing issues at Union Court as well. One prevalent theme among the reviews is that caregivers often lack adequate communication skills, with complaints regarding their limited ability to speak English effectively. This language barrier can create misunderstandings and hinder proper care, which is particularly alarming when dealing with vulnerable populations like those suffering from dementia or Alzheimer's disease. Several reviewers expressed their dissatisfaction with these gaps in communication and warned others against putting their loved ones in an environment where caregivers cannot adequately meet their needs.

The owner’s qualifications have come under scrutiny as well, with some reviewers asserting that he misrepresents his credentials. Although he boasts having a doctorate, it is reportedly not in any medical field relevant to elderly care; instead, he holds a degree in finance. Families looking for competent medical oversight may find this fact disconcerting. Rather than hiring qualified personnel to ensure optimal elder care practices are maintained within the facility, it seems that decisions are driven by financial gain rather than fostering competency among staff members.

Furthermore, food quality has been another area of dissatisfaction highlighted in these reviews. Families were led to believe that gourmet meals would be part of the experience at Union Court but quickly discovered this claim did not hold true upon moving their relatives in. Reviewers described meals as lacking variety and substance—an indication that cost-cutting measures may be impacting even essential services meant to enhance residents' quality of life. The disparity between promotional promises and actual experiences indicates that management prioritizes challenges over genuine support systems intended for elderly residents.

Amidst these negative impressions surfaced some positive elements associated with staff members who genuinely care about residents’ welfare. Some reviewers fondly recounted experiences with specific workers who showed competence and compassion towards residents in need of assistance—particularly noting an LPN house manager who was both experienced and knowledgeable about Alzheimer’s care. While her intent seemed centered on resident safety and comfort—evidenced by her recommendation of a different secure facility—this professionalism stands starkly juxtaposed against management's questionable practices.

Ultimately, several families felt compelled to relocate their loved ones elsewhere due to myriad issues plaguing Union Court: inconsistent caregiving standards, potential neglect arising from financial motives rather than altruistic values, poor communication capabilities among staff members leading confusion or misunderstanding regarding resident needs—and perhaps most importantly—concerns surrounding safety measures implemented within the premises itself were inadequately addressed prior family placements. These shared narratives reflect disillusionment towards what could have been a nurturing home environment but fell short when transparency faltered under profit-driven management approaches instead.
